Brazil forward Fred is hopeful that owners Fluminense will give him some time off following the conclusion of the World Cup.
The 30 year-old, who has now retired from international football, told reporters that he needed time to clear his head after a difficult tournament.
“The club offered me a break after the Confederations Cup and I didn’t take it, he said, as reported by Football Italia. “But now I need time to compose myself and forget everything that happened here.”
